Description
Describe the bug
If my program is attempting to get all access package assignment requests, and comes across a request that has Request Type "UserExtend" it will throw and exception with the error stated in the title.
This type has been documented as a supported type in AccessPackageAssignmentRequest, but is not implemented in the AccessPackageRequestType.
Expected behavior
When making the call to retrieve all access package requests, it should return all requests - of all types, and not throw an exception.
How to reproduce
Requirement: Have an access package request of type "UserExtend" and an initialized GraphServiceClient.
then execute the code:
access_package_requests= await graph_client.identity_governance.entitlement_management.assignment_requests.get()
SDK Version
1.5.3
